Ina Garten's Mustard-Roasted Chicken Recipe

Ina Garten's Mustard-Roasted Chicken

Chicken pieces are marinated and roasted in a bold mixture of Dijon mustard, whole-grain mustard, white wine, garlic, thyme, and olive oil. Serve the chicken hot or at room temperature with plenty of mustard pan juices.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 45 minutes

Servings: 4 servings

Ingredients
  

Mustard Marinade
  • 4 cloves Gar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h thyme leaves, minced
  • 1 tablespoon Kosher salt
  • 2 teaspoons Freshly ground black pepper
  • 1 cup Dry white wine
  • 1/2 cup Good olive oil
  • 1/2 cup Dijon mustard
  • 1/2 cup Whole-grain mustard
Chicken
  • 4 pounds Chicken, cut into 8 pieces

Method
 

Step-by-Step
  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F. Place the chicken pieces in a large bowl and add the garlic, thyme, kosher salt, black pepper, white wine, olive oil, Dijon mustard, and whole-grain mustard.
  2. Stir thoroughly until every piece is evenly coated with the mustard mixture. Cover and refrigerate for several hours or overnight if desired, then bring the chicken close to room temperature before roasting.
  3. Transfer the chicken and all of the marinade to a large roasting pan approximately 12 x 16 inches. Arrange the pieces skin-side up in a single layer without crowding.
  4. Roast for 45 to 60 minutes, until the chicken is browned and cooked through. Check the thickest portions with an instant-read thermometer and make sure they reach 165°F.
  5. Serve hot or at room temperature, spooning the mustard pan juices over the chicken before bringing it to the table.

Notes

Keep the chicken skin-side up and avoid crowding the roasting pan so the skin browns rather than steams. The whole-grain mustard adds texture, while Dijon supplies most of the sharpness. Refrigerate leftovers promptly and reheat gently with some pan juices to help keep the chicken moist.
